在当今数字化时代,企业的信息系统变得越来越复杂,需要处理来自不同来源、不同格式的数据,并确保这些数据能够高效、安全地在各个系统之间流动,中间件服务器,作为现代IT架构中的关键组件,扮演着至关重要的角色,它不仅简化了应用程序的开发、部署和管理过程,还极大地提高了系统的可扩展性、可靠性和安全性,本文将深入探讨中间件服务器的概念、功能、类型及其在企业IT架构中的应用价值。
一、中间件服务器概述
中间件服务器是一种独立的系统软件或服务程序,位于客户端应用程序和数据库或其他资源之间,负责管理计算资源和网络通信,为应用程序提供通用的服务和交互功能,它通过提供标准化的接口和协议,使得不同的应用程序能够相互通信和协作,从而降低了开发复杂性,提高了系统的灵活性和互操作性。
二、中间件服务器的核心功能
1、消息传递:中间件支持多种消息传递机制,如同步、异步、发布/订阅等,确保信息在不同系统间准确无误地传输。
2、事务管理:保证数据的一致性和完整性,即使在分布式环境中也能实现复杂的事务处理。
3、负载均衡:动态分配系统资源,根据服务器的负载情况调整请求分配,提高整体性能。
4、安全性:提供加密、认证、授权等安全措施,保护数据传输和访问的安全。
5、监控与管理:实时监控系统状态,提供日志记录、性能分析等功能,便于运维管理。
三、中间件服务器的主要类型
1、消息中间件:如IBM MQ、Apache Kafka,专注于高效、可靠的消息传递。
2、交易中间件:如BEA Tuxedo、IBM WebSphere MQ,用于管理分布式事务,确保数据一致性。
3、应用服务器:如Apache Tomcat、JBoss,提供Web应用的运行环境,支持Java EE等标准。
4、集成中间件:如Apache Camel、MuleSoft,帮助企业整合异构系统,实现数据和服务的无缝连接。
5、API网关:如Kong、Apigee,作为微服务架构中的入口点,负责路由、认证、限流等。
四、中间件服务器在企业IT架构中的应用价值
1、加速数字化转型:通过简化系统集成,快速响应市场变化,支持新业务模式的创新。
2、提升运营效率:自动化业务流程,减少手动干预,提高生产效率和服务质量。
3、增强系统稳定性:通过故障隔离、自动恢复等机制,提高系统的容错性和可用性。
4、促进云原生转型:中间件支持容器化、微服务架构,是企业向云计算迁移的重要支撑。
5、保障数据安全:强化数据传输和存储的安全性,符合行业合规要求。
五、面临的挑战与未来趋势
尽管中间件服务器为企业带来了诸多便利,但也面临着一些挑战,如技术选型复杂、维护成本高、安全性问题等,随着云计算、人工智能等技术的发展,中间件将进一步向智能化、自动化方向发展,例如利用AI进行智能路由、自适应负载均衡等,同时加强安全防护能力,以更好地适应不断变化的企业需求和外部环境。
中间件服务器作为连接不同系统和应用的桥梁,不仅解决了“信息孤岛”问题,还为企业的数字化转型提供了强有力的支持,在选择和部署中间件时,企业应根据自身业务特点和技术栈进行综合考虑,以最大化其效益,推动业务持续创新和发展。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态